+Requirements for the borg single-file binary, esp. (g)libc?
|
|
|
+-----------------------------------------------------------
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+We try to build the binary on old, but still supported systems - to keep the
|
|
|
+minimum requirement for the (g)libc low. The (g)libc can't be bundled into
|
|
|
+the binary as it needs to fit your kernel and OS, but Python and all other
|
|
|
+required libraries will be bundled into the binary.
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+If your system fulfills the minimum (g)libc requirement (see the README that
|
|
|
+is released with the binary), there should be no problem. If you are slightly
|
|
|
+below the required version, maybe just try. Due to the dynamic loading (or not
|
|
|
+loading) of some shared libraries, it might still work depending on what
|
|
|
+libraries are actually loaded and used.
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+In the borg git repository, there is scripts/glibc_check.py that can determine
|
|
|
+(based on the symbols' versions they want to link to) whether a set of given
|
|
|
+(Linux) binaries works with a given glibc version.
